Lazy Guy Rellenos with Red & Green Chile Blend
(This recipe serves 2–4 depending on appetite)
Ingredients:
- 2–3 corn tortillas per person
- 1 cheese-stuffed, roasted and peeled long green chile per tortilla
- (Use sharp cheddar, longhorn, or Monterey Jack — whatever suits your mood!)
- Shredded extra cheese for finishing
- Fresh Chile Co. Red & Green Blend (as needed)
- Eggs (1 per person), cooked sunny side up
- Cooking spray
- Optional: crushed red chile flakes
Instructions:
1. Prep the Tortillas: Heat a skillet over medium-high. Lightly spritz with cooking spray. Add tortillas and warm just until flexible.
2. Stuff and Fold: Place one stuffed chile in each tortilla and fold over.
3. Heat the Rellenos: Place folded rellenos back in the skillet, turning once to warm through, melt the cheese, and lightly brown the tortilla. Tortillas should be soft enough to cut with a fork.
4. Cook the Eggs: Remove rellenos and set on plates. Spritz skillet again and cook eggs sunny side up.
5. Assemble the Plate: Spoon warmed Red & Green Chile Blend over each relleno, sprinkle with extra cheese, and top with eggs.
6. Add Heat (Optional): A shake or two of crushed red chile flakes gives an extra kick.
Serving Tip: This is a quick and hearty breakfast or brunch favorite — perfect for anyone craving bold chile flavor without the fuss.
